Anyone who's priced plantation shutters lately knows how expensive
they can be, costing several hundred dollars per opening. Not
surprisingly, Yankee ingenuity and thrift prevail and Norm creates
some stunning shutters in the workshop. He first builds a
collection of jigs, which are necessary to drill holes, set staples
and mortise hinges; then he shapes the individual basswood slats,
mounts them on a control rod and positions the whole assembly into
a frame of poplar that's then spray painted.
